It has a high strength-to-weight ratio, good corrosion resistance, good formability, and visual appeal. These factors have resulted in its raised popularity over the last few years. Pure aluminum has actually restricted applications, so it is often incorporated with various other elements, such as silicon, magnesium, and manganese to create alloys.


Different aspects and amounts produce a wide range of preferable physical and chemical residential or commercial properties. And the Light weight aluminum Organization (AA), based in The United States and copyright, has developed specifications that manage aluminum alloys' structure, residential or commercial properties, and nomenclature. There are two sorts of light weight aluminum alloys functioned and cast. Factory employees develop these alloy enters various ways, which significantly affects their attributes.

Cast light weight aluminum alloys are made by melting pure light weight aluminum and integrating it with various other steels while in fluid type. The mix is put right into a sand, die, or financial investment mold.

Wrought aluminum alloys also start by incorporating molten aluminum with other metals. Unlike cast alloys, nonetheless, they are formed into their final form through processes such as extrusion, rolling, and flexing after the steel has solidified right into billets or ingots.


There are numerous minor differences between wrought and cast aluminum alloys, such as that cast alloys can contain much more substantial quantities of various other steels than wrought alloys. The most notable distinction in between these alloys is the construction process via which they will go to deliver the last product. Aside from some surface area therapies, cast alloys will exit their mold and mildew in nearly the precise solid kind preferred, whereas wrought alloys will undertake a number of adjustments while in their strong state

Various components need various manufacturing methods to cast aluminum, such as sand spreading or die casting.


Pass away casting is the name provided to Web Site the process of creating intricate steel elements with use mold and mildews of the part, likewise known as dies. The procedure utilizes non-ferrous metals which do not include iron, such as aluminum, zinc and magnesium, due to the desirable residential properties of the steels such as low weight, higher conductivity, non-magnetic conductivity and resistance to corrosion.


Die casting production is fast, making high production levels of components simple. It generates more parts than any various other procedure, with a high level of accuracy and repeatability. To find out even more about die spreading and die spreading materials made use of at the same time, continued reading. There are 3 sub-processes that fall under the group of die spreading: gravity pass away casting (or permanent mold and mildew spreading), low-pressure die casting and high-pressure die spreading.

After the pureness of the alloy is evaluated, dies are developed - aluminum casting company. To prepare the dies for casting, it is vital that the dies are clean, so that no residue from previous manufacturings continue to be.


The pure metal, additionally referred to as ingot, is added to the heater and maintained the molten temperature of the metal, which is after that moved to the injection chamber and injected into the die. The stress is after that maintained as the metal strengthens. Once the metal strengthens, the cooling procedure begins.


The thicker the wall surface of the part, the longer the cooling time as a result of the amount of indoor metal that likewise requires to cool. After the component is fully cooled, the die halves open and an ejection system presses the part out. Following the ejection, the die is closed for the next shot cycle.

The flash is the additional product that is cast during the procedure. This need to be trimmed off using a trim tool to leave simply the primary part. Deburring removes the smaller items, called burrs, after the cutting process. Lastly, the element is polished, or burnished, to give it a smooth finish.


Today, leading producers make use of x-ray screening to see the entire inside of elements without reducing into them. To obtain to the ended up product, there are 3 main alloys utilized as die casting material to choose from: zinc, aluminum and magnesium.


Zinc is one of the most used alloys for die casting due to its reduced price of raw materials. Its rust resistance additionally enables the parts to be long enduring, and it is one of the more castable alloys due to its lower melting factor.
